What problem does it solve?

This Skill structures the diagnostic process for SuS errors, helping teachers distinguish conceptual misconceptions, procedural misapplications, and slips, so feedback can be precisely targeted and learners develop error-awareness.

Core Features & Use Cases

  • Classify each error as conceptual, procedural, or a fleeting (slip) error with justification.
  • Analyze root causes and generate targeted interventions, plus a guided self-analysis scaffold for students.
  • Use across subjects and tasks to support formative assessment, feedback design, and metacognitive skill development.
  • Provide a self-analysis framework that supports students in reflecting on their own errors and accountability.

What is the difference between conceptual misconceptions and procedural errors in formative assessment?

Conceptual misconceptions in formative assessment indicate a breakdown in foundational understanding, whereas procedural errors represent misapplications in executing steps, both requiring distinct targeted interventions.

Why does my student feedback fail to address the root causes of recurring mistakes?

Student feedback often fails to address root causes when errors are treated uniformly instead of being classified into conceptual, procedural, or slip categories to uncover underlying misconceptions and procedural gaps.
